Understanding Butt Lift Procedures and Their Costs

The butt lift encompasses several techniques, each with distinct characteristics, advantages, and price ranges. It is essential to understand these variations to make an informed decision aligned with your aesthetic goals, safety considerations, and budget.

Types of Butt Lift Procedures and Their Price Factors

  • Traditional Butt Lift (Surgical Kim Procedure): This involves removing excess skin and repositioning the buttocks for a lifted, firmer look.
  • Brazilian Butt Lift (BBL): Utilizes liposuction to harvest fat from other areas and injects it into the buttocks for natural enlargement.
  • Non-Surgical Butt Lift: Employs injectable fillers, threads, or ultrasound treatments to stimulate collagen and lift the tissue.

Factors Influencing Butt Lift Prices

Understanding what influences the butt lift prices is crucial when budgeting for your cosmetic enhancement. Several key factors determine the overall cost:

1. Procedure Type and Complexity

The method you choose directly impacts the cost. Surgical procedures, such as the traditional butt lift or Brazilian Butt Lift, tend to be more expensive due to the complexity, anesthesia, and hospital resources involved. Non-surgical options are typically more affordable but may require maintenance treatments.

2. Geographical Location of the Medical Center

Prices vary significantly based on geographic region. Urban centers or cities with a high concentration of aesthetic clinics often have higher fees due to increased demand, higher operational costs, and skilled specialist availability.

3. Surgeon’s Experience and Reputation

Renowned surgeons with extensive experience and exceptional credentials tend to charge premium prices, which reflect their expertise, safety record, and aesthetic reputation.

4. Facility and Technology Used

State-of-the-art medical centers equipped with the latest technology and safety standards tend to incorporate higher operational costs, influencing the overall price of the butt lift.

5. Anesthesia and Post-Operative Care

Invasive procedures typically require anesthesia, which adds to the cost. Additionally, comprehensive post-operative care, including follow-up visits and medications, must be factored into the overall price.

Expected Price Ranges for Butt Lift Prices

While prices vary widely, here are approximate ranges based on procedure type:

  • Traditional Butt Lift: $8,000 – $15,000
  • Brazilian Butt Lift (BBL): $6,000 – $12,000
  • Non-Surgical Butt Lift: $1,500 – $4,500 per session

Note: These figures are estimates and can vary based on individual circumstances and location. Always consult with a qualified specialist for a personalized quote.

Investing in Quality: Why Price Shouldn’t Be the Sole Consideration

Although budget is a significant factor, prioritizing quality, safety, and the surgeon’s experience is vital. A lower-cost procedure performed by an inexperienced provider may lead to unsatisfactory results or complications, ultimately increasing costs due to revision surgeries or medical treatments.

How to Choose the Right Medical Center for Your Butt Lift

When researching butt lift prices, consider the following to ensure you select the best facility:

  • Certification and Accreditation: Verify that the clinic and surgeon are certified by reputable medical boards.
  • Consultation Experience: Choose centers that offer thorough consultations, transparency on costs, and clear communication about procedures and expectations.
  • Patient Testimonials and Before/After Photos: Review previous patient results to assess the quality of work.
  • Safety Record: Ensure the facility maintains high standards of hygiene, safety protocols, and emergency preparedness.
  • Post-Operative Support: Access to comprehensive aftercare ensures optimal healing and satisfaction.
